Why Double Glazing Repair Is Necessary

Double glazing keeps homes warm and free of drafts. However, with time they may start to fail. This is due to numerous factors, including condensation between the windows or even a blown-out window.

Thankfully, this is a situation that can be easily repaired. In this article, we will explore some common double-glazing repair issues and how they can be repaired.

Frames

The frames of double glazing are essential components of your doors and windows. They shield the glass panes from moisture dirt, and other contaminants. They are susceptible to deterioration over time. It is important to know that you can repair them without having to replace the entire window. Double-glazed windows can be restored to their original state with a good repair. This will improve the aesthetic appeal of your home and boost the value of its resales.

A faulty frame is a common reason for double glazing failure. The issue can cause draughts and heat loss. This can result in a loss of money on energy bills and could damage the interior of your home. It is essential to repair your double glazing as fast as possible if you notice any issues.

It is recommended to hire a professional double glazing repair company to fix the frames. They will be able to provide you with a range of options, so you can select the most suitable one for your needs. Additionally, they will have the tools needed to complete the task quickly and efficiently.

Double-glazed windows will be more efficient when repaired. Double glazing is designed so that it can keep warm air in your home during winter, and cool air out in summer. However, if the frame or frame is damaged, it won't be able to achieve this.

UPVC is the most sought-after material for double glazing frames. It is popular because it's robust and requires minimal maintenance. It is also relatively cheap. However, UPVC isn't as flexible as other materials and might not be suitable for all types of homes.

Another popular choice for double glazing frames is aluminium. This is due to the fact that it is lightweight and durable, but it might not be the best choice for homeowners due to its rigidity.

Glass

Sometimes double-glazed windows can be difficult to open. This is usually due to condensation between the panes or by a broken seal. If you suspect that this is a problem with your double glazing you might want to contact an experienced repair service.

The good news is, the majority of double-glazed window issues can be resolved without having to replace the entire window. In certain cases, such as a misted glass it is possible to solve the issue without replacing the frame. This is because a misty window is often caused by poor quality seals, and this can be fixed easily.

To repair a double glazing window that has become misted first thing that must be taken care of is removing the condensation and smears from the window panes. This can be accomplished by placing the double-glazed unit on a flat work bench (ideally with a soft, absorbent surface such as duvet or towel between them to avoid scratches) and then using a scraper to break it off from the frame. Once the two pieces of glass are separated, they can then be cleaned using window cleaning spray to remove any marks or smears and to help re-bond them when the repair is completed.

After both glass panes have been cleaned and sanded, the edges that were fixed to the frame will be re-bonded with a special sealant. After the glass is cleaned it can be placed back into the frame and new seals can be applied to prevent it from misting once more.

It is important to remember that replacing double-glazed glass could be risky and should be done only by experts with experience in this area. It is a complicated process that requires specialized equipment and is not a DIY task. This is an excellent chance to upgrade your single-glazed window from standard to energy efficient glass A-rated, which can cut down on your heating costs and make your home more comfortable. The cost of this can be significantly less than that of replacing a complete window.

Locks

Window locks are important to secure windows particularly in areas susceptible to burglaries. They can also reduce the amount of drafts that enter the home, which is a common problem with double glazing that is fitted to older homes. Whether you have uPVC windows or double-glazed ones the lock mechanism will have to be replaced periodically. There are several ways to fix your windows' locks based on the kind of lock you have installed.

The majority of double-glazed windows have a lock that is keyed that can be opened and closed by inserting keys into the lock cylinder. The lock is situated on the side of a double-hung window and is among the most well-known types of double glazing locks available. There are also other types of windows locks including sash and crank handles.

Double-glazed windows that do not shut properly can create drafts inside your home, allowing valuable heat to escape and placing your family at risk of being burglarized. This issue can also result in damp and water damage if not dealt with quickly. Another issue that is common to uPVC Windows is that the seal that holds the glass together may start to deteriorate or shrink. This is an natural process that may result from fluctuating temperatures and weather conditions. As time passes the seal can become brittle or can shrink from the frame which allows air to get between the panes of glass and result in draughts.

Seals

Repairing your double-glazed windows promptly will ensure it's as durable and efficient as is possible. A professional Glazier will have the experience and tools required to repair the damage quickly and safely. They will also be capable of providing you with any advice on care and maintenance that might help to extend its lifespan.

Window seals are an important component of double glazed windows as they provide insulation and keep out moisture. If your window seals become damaged or UPVC Window Repairs Near Me lose their effectiveness and you notice condensation forming inside the glass pains and fogging of the windows. Repair these issues promptly as they will impact the efficiency of your windows and their ability to cut down on energy bills.

It is time to call an expert for double glazing repairs if you notice condensation, fogging or draughts. It is not necessary to replace your double-glazing when the issue is caused by condensation or moisture, as it will usually disappear over time if you ensure adequate ventilation and a dehumidified home environment.

However, increased energy costs are another sign that double-glazed windows require replacement or repair because they let warm air out of your home causing your heating system to work harder. If you're not sure whether your more expensive energy bills are the result of broken seals, it's a good idea to contact the company who installed them to find out what the issue might be.
